LESSON 2
How Long Does Salvation Last?
Many times, people are confused about
the length of salvation or their security as a believer. People worry about
"losing" their salvation, or "what happens when I sin"? Many
Christians have been missing a great blessing in their Christian living simply
because they were not sure.

CONCLUSION:
My dear Christian friend,
you are saved not just now, you are saved forever. You now have the power of God
in you (The Holy Spirit), Who will give you victory over every sin. Remember, if
God can save you, God can deliver you from any habit, attitude, or action that
is sin. Read Proverbs 3:5-6.(It is always good to write the verses out - write
them on this page).
